Summary
Rep. Mark Messmer (R) has represented Indiana's 8th Congressional District for one term. This session, Rep. Messmer has sponsored 16 bills, co-sponsored 220 bills, voted Yes 361 times, and No 104 times.

Lobbying
27 clients and 28 firms named 10 of the bills sponsored by Rep. Mark Messmer in 68 quarterly filings under the Lobbying Disclosure Act.
Registrants filing on those bills, and the bills they named most.
The bills most often named.
| Bill | Title | Filings |
|---|---|---|
| H.R. 6213 | Heat Workforce Standards Act of 2025 | 21 |
| H.R. 1018 | INSTRUCT Act of 2025 | 12 |
| H.R. 2270 | Empowering Employer Child and Elder Care Solutions Act | 9 |
| H.J.Res. 15 | Providing for congressional disapproval under chapter 8 of title 5, United States Code, of the rule… | 8 |
| H.R. 7469 | SNAP Online Access Act of 2026 | 7 |
| H.R. 4107 | GOLDEN DOME Act of 2025 | 5 |
| H.R. 6466 | Forced Abortion Prevention and Accountability Act | 3 |
| H.R. 7720 | Child Care Payment Integrity and Fraud Accountability Act of 2026 | 3 |
| H.R. 6657 | Restaurant Meals Program Reform Act of 2025 | 2 |
| H.Res. 428 | Expressing support for the designation of May 2025 as "Moving Month". | 1 |
1 of the lobbyists named on those filings share a name with someone in the congressional record — a former member, or a name in the House staff directory. This is a name match, not a verified identity: we hold today’s House roster and no employment history at all, and the Senate publishes no staff directory, so the names are shown rather than only counted.
